A store has been selling 300 Blu-ray disc players a week at $600 each. A market survey indicates that for each $40 rebate offere

d to buyers, the number of units sold will increase by 80 a week. Find the demand function and the revenue function. How large a rebate should the store offer to maximize\

Answer:

75 $

Step-by-step explanation:

According to problem statement p(300) = 600

And we know that with a rebate of 40 $, numbers of units sold will increase by 80 then if x is number of units sold, the increase in units is

(  x  - 300 )  , and the price decrease

(1/80)*40  =  0,5

Then the demand function is:

D(x)  =  600  - 0,5* ( x - 300 )  (1)

And revenue function is:

R(x) =  x * (D(x)   ⇒   R(x) =  x* [  600  - 0,5* ( x - 300 )]

R(x) = 600*x  - 0,5*x * ( x - 300 )

R(x) = 600*x - 0,5*x² - 150*x

R(x) = 450*x  - (1/2)*x²

Now taking derivatives on both sides of the equation we get

R´(x) =  450  - x

R´(x) =  0       ⇒   450  - x = 0

x = 450 units

We can observe that for   0 < x  < 450  R(x) > 0 then R(x) has a maximum for x = 450

Plugging this value in demand equation, we get the rebate for maximize revenue

D(450)  =  600  - 0,5* ( x - 300 )

D(450)  =  600 - 225 + 150

D(450)  =

D(450)  =  600 - 0,5*( 150)

D(450)  =  600 - 75

D(450)  = 525

And the rebate must be

600 - 525  = 75 $

The width of a rectangle is 8 inches and the perimeter is 26 inches. What is the length of the rectangle?
fredd [130]

Length of the rectangle is 5 inches

Step-by-step explanation:

  • Step 1: Perimeter of the rectangle = 26 in and width = 8 in. Find the length.

Perimeter of the rectangle = 2(length + width)

26 = 2(length + 8)

13 = length + 8

length = 13 - 8

Length = 5 in
